Owner must ensure that all players know and follow these rules 
for safe operation of the system.
WARNING
•  DO NOT HANG on the rim or any part of the system including 
backboard, support braces or net.
•  During play, especially when performing dunk type activities, 
keep player's face away from the backboard, rim and net. 
Serious injury could occur if teeth/face come in contact with 
backboard, rim or net.
•  Do not slide, climb, shake or play on base and/or pole.
•  After assembly is complete, fill system completely with water 
or sand. Never leave system in an upright position without 
filling base with weight, as system may tip over causing 
injuries.
•  When adjusting height or moving system, keep hands and 
fingers away from moving parts.
•  Do not allow children to move or adjust system.
•  During play, do not wear jewelry (rings, watches, necklaces, 
etc.). Objects may entangle in net.
•  Surface beneath the base must be smooth and free of gravel or 
other sharp objects. Punctures cause leakage and could cause 
system to tip over.
•  Keep organic material away from pole base. Grass, litter, etc. 
could cause corrosion and/or deterioration.
•  Check pole system for signs of corrosion (rust, pitting, 
chipping) and repaint with exterior enamel paint. If rust has 
penetrated through the steel anywhere, replace pole 
immediately.
•  Check system before each use for proper ballast, loose 
hardware, excessive wear and signs of corrosion and repair 
before use.
•  Check system before each use for instability.
•  Do not use system during windy and/or severe weather 
conditions; system may tip over. Place system in the storage 
position and/or in an area protected from the wind and free 
from personal property and/or overhead wires.
•  Never play on damaged equipment.
•  When moving system, use caution to keep mechanism from 
shifting.
•  Keep pole top covered with cap at all times.
•  Do not allow water in tank to freeze. During sub-freezing 
weather add 2 gallons of non-toxic antifreeze, sand or empty 
tank completely and store. (Do not use salt.)
•  While moving system, do not allow anyone to stand or sit on 
base or have added ballasting on base.
•  Do not leave system unsupervised or play on system when 
wheels are engaged for moving.
•  Use Caution when moving system across uneven surfaces. 
System may tip over.
•  Use extreme caution if placing system on sloped surface. 
System may tip over more easily.
•  See instruction manual for proper installation and 
maintenance.

BEFORE YOU START!
To ensure optimal playability of backboard system, a
close tolerance fit between the elevator components
and hardware is required. Test-fit large bolts into large
holes of elevator tubes, backboard brackets, and
triangle plates. Carefully rock them in a circular
motion to ream out any excess paint from holes if
necessary.
